NAME
function::kernel_string_utf32 - Retrieves UTF-32 string from kernel memory
SYNOPSIS
kernel_string_utf32:string(addr:long)
ARGUMENTS
addr The kernel address to retrieve the string from
DESCRIPTION
This function returns a null terminated UTF-8 string converted from the UTF-32 string at a given kernel memory address. Reports an error on string copy fault or conversion error. SystemTap Tapset Reference June 2014 FUNCTION::KERNEL_STR(3stap)
